Preview

Shops and canal with gondola at Venetian Casino Resort, Macao, Taipa, China, Asia
Shops and canal with gondola at Venetian Casino Resort, Macao, Taipa, China, Asia
Image ID: 1113-16626
Artist: Karl Johaentges
Purchase a commercial license Buy framed prints & more from our print store